Butler Machinery Company and Butler Ag Equipment are seeking self-motivated, customer-focused service technicians to join our team. If you have a passion for construction, agriculture, or power industries, enjoy working independently and as part of a team, and are eager to advance your career, you'll thrive with us. In this role, you'll use your mechanical skills to perform maintenance, diagnostics, and repairs on customer equipment. Since 1955, Butler has been a family-owned company committed to developing employee leadership and promoting from within.

Our ideal candidate values strong relationships, customer service, excellence, integrity, accountability, and safety.

Learn more about our technician careers at Butler Machinery and Butler Ag Equipment.

Pay Scale: $30.56/hr - $49.51/hr, DOE.

Responsibilities:

  • Perform maintenance, diagnostics, and repairs on construction, agriculture, or power equipment.
  • Diagnose issues within diesel systems, including hydraulics, electrical, and power trains.
  • Work overtime as needed.
  • Maintain a safe and clean work environment.
  • Work independently and as part of a team.
  • Engage in ongoing learning to stay current with industry standards.
  • Lift up to 70 lbs.
  • Travel to various Butler and customer locations.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
